Transaction 259df7584eefc6f3bcfdb7b7c753b8681b158e7757e84e1eef2bd37b763f2815
2 Input
2 Outputs
- 259df7584eefc6f3bcfdb7b7c753b8681b158e7757e84e1eef2bd37b763f2815:0
- 259df7584eefc6f3bcfdb7b7c753b8681b158e7757e84e1eef2bd37b763f2815:1
value 994760000
address 17iL2xYAPfv8e8YGv6oo3VnYivurj66BWP
value 150851400
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C